Warning Signs You Need Emergency Tarping Services
Sometimes the damage isn’t immediately obvious, or it might seem minor at first glance. However, small breaches can lead to significant problems over time. Recognizing these early warning signs can save you a lot of trouble and expense down the road. Ignoring them is a gamble you don’t want to take with your home’s integrity.
Visible Holes or Missing Shingles
This is the most obvious sign. If you can see daylight through your roof or notice large sections of missing shingles after a storm, immediate tarping is essential. These openings are direct pathways for water and pests.
Persistent Leaks After Rain
Even if the leak seems small, if it continues to drip after rain stops, it indicates water is trapped and finding its way in. A tarp can prevent that slow, steady drip from causing hidden water damage to your ceilings and walls.
Sagging Ceiling or Wall Areas
A visible sag is a serious structural warning sign. It means water has saturated the insulation and drywall, compromising their integrity. Prompt tarping can help prevent further structural collapse and limit interior water spread.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Those tell-tale brown or yellow rings are a clear sign of past or present water intrusion. While the stain itself might be cosmetic, it indicates a breach that needs immediate attention to prevent mold and rot. Stopping the source is critical.
Wind Damage to Roof Edges or Flashing
Strong winds can lift or tear away roof edges and flashing, creating gaps that allow water to seep underneath shingles and into your attic or walls. Even without a visible hole, this compromised area needs protection. We can seal these vulnerable roof sections.
Emergency Tarping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, Isolated Hole in Shingles (no wind) | Yes, if comfortable and safe on a low-slope roof. | No | Can be a temporary fix with proper materials, but professional assessment is still wise. |
| Large Area of Missing Shingles or Exposed Plywood | No | Yes | Requires specialized knowledge of roof structure and secure anchoring to prevent further damage. |
| Damage to Roof Edges or Ridge Cap from Wind | No | Yes | These areas are critical for water shedding and require specific techniques to seal effectively against wind-driven rain. |
| Hole Caused by Falling Debris (tree branch, etc.) | No | Yes | Impacts can cause unseen structural damage; professional assessment is vital. |
| Damage on a Steep or High Roof | Absolutely Not | Yes | Safety is the primary concern; falls from roofs can be fatal. |
| Multiple Leaks or Widespread Damage | No | Yes | Complex damage requires a comprehensive approach and experienced technicians to address all entry points. |
While a very minor shingle issue might seem like a DIY job, most emergency situations involving roof damage are best handled by professionals. The risks associated with falling, causing further damage, or not securing the tarp properly are significant. Is emergency tarping covered by homeowners insurance?
Often, yes. Emergency tarping services are typically considered a necessary step to prevent further damage, and therefore, may be covered by your homeowners insurance policy. It’s always best to check your specific policy details. We can work directly with your insurance adjuster to ensure proper documentation and billing for the temporary protective measures we provide.
How long does a temporary roof tarp last?
A properly installed temporary tarp can last for several weeks, sometimes even a few months, depending on weather conditions and the quality of installation. However, it’s crucial to remember that it’s a temporary solution. Our priority is to get your roof permanently repaired as quickly as possible to ensure long-term protection for your home.
